Sneak a peek at some up-and-coming bands on the rise, White Arrows and Painted Palms, performing a free show in The Depot at SF State on Wednesday, January 30,2013.
SFSU Free Concert Lineup | January 30, 2013
- White Arrows are a psychotropical pop group from Los Angeles. The band toured with Cults, Those Darlins, The Naked and Famous, played at Sasquatch 2011, and opened up for Santigold.
- Painted Palms, a Bay Area duo, “is another entry in the post-Animal Collective dream-pop stakes, with swirling electronics and songs about water and sleep.” – Pitchfork
- Stupid Bummed: Synth Pop band from SFSU
